Background Information
APBB1(Amyloid-beta A4 precursor protein-binding family B member 1) encoded FE65 protein. It was known as a binding partner of APP in the Alzheimer's disease studies, and expressed at high levels in brain especially in cerebellum, hippocampus, and cortex. FE65 and FE65-like (FE65L or FE65L1) proteins are cytoplasmic adaptor proteins that possess two phosphotyrosine binding domains (PTB1 and PTB2) and one WW binding domain (PMID:22429478). After phosphorylation modification, the band of FE65 protein would appear around 100 kDa. However, some tested a non-specific band at 55-60 kDa, it was refer to as FE65-like protein(PMID:12843239).
